Company Description

Colliers is a leading commercial real estate services company, providing a full range of services to real estate occupiers, developers, and investors on a local, national, and international basis. Services include brokerage sales and leasing (landlord and tenant representation), real estate management, valuation, consulting, project management, project marketing and research. We provide our services across the core sectors (office, industrial, retail and hotel) as well as many specialised property types.

The UK business is headquartered in London, with over 1200 specialists throughout 16 offices across the UK and Ireland.

Job Description

Support the EMEA OS SmartFlex team in creating and producing availability reports, pitches and strategy led research papers this involves research and outreach across the world, setting up site inspection schedules for our clients under time constraints.

Comprehensive support to the Head of Flexible Workspace Consulting, including but not limited to, co-ordinating and updating diaries, organising travel and hotels.

Creating pitch documents and support on marketing such as social media campaigns.

Administrative support to the rest of the team.

Arranging meetings and booking appropriate meeting rooms, including preparing agendas, taking, and typing up minutes/action points.

Preparing fee invoices as required.

Management of fee forecasts and internal reporting working in conjunction with the wider team.

Assistance in preparing all documents in accordance with Company templates.

Any other task that may reasonably be requested.
